Types of Turf Soccer Boots

Type Description Best For
Turf Shoes (TF) Designed specifically for turf surfaces with short, rubber studs. Training and casual play.
Artificial Grass (AG) Built for use on artificial grass, often with a mix of conical and bladed studs for better grip. Competitive play on AG fields.
Firm Ground (FG) Suitable for natural grass fields but can be used on turf; features longer studs. Players transitioning between surfaces.
Soft Ground (SG) Designed for muddy or soft natural fields; not recommended for turf. Wet, soft grass fields only.

Why Choose Turf Soccer Boots?

Playing soccer on artificial turf surfaces requires specialized footwear to prevent injuries and enhance performance. Turf soccer boots are designed with unique features that cater to the specific needs of players on these surfaces. Here are some reasons why investing in the right pair is crucial:

  • Injury Prevention: Turf surfaces can be unforgiving, and using the wrong footwear may lead to slips, falls, or twisted ankles. Turf boots provide the necessary grip and stability.
  • Enhanced Traction: The stud patterns on turf boots are specifically designed to offer better grip on artificial surfaces, allowing players to change direction quickly without losing balance.
  • Comfort: High-quality turf soccer boots are built with comfort in mind, featuring cushioned insoles and breathable materials to keep your feet comfortable during lengthy games.

Features to Look for in Turf Soccer Boots

When choosing the best turf soccer boots, consider the following features:

1. Stud Pattern

The stud configuration is crucial for traction. Look for a shorter, denser pattern designed for optimal grip on artificial turf, as found in models from brands like Adidas and Nike.

2. Material

Turf boots are typically made from synthetic materials or leather. Synthetic options offer lightweight breathability, while leather provides durability and comfort. Brands like www.thisisamericansoccer.com recommend the Adidas Performance Mundial Team for its leather construction.

3. Fit and Comfort

Ensure the boots fit snugly without being too tight. A good fit enhances performance and reduces the risk of blisters. Consider trying on various styles, as mentioned in reviews by www.soccershoeguide.com.

4. Cushioning

Adequate cushioning helps absorb impact during play. Look for boots with padded insoles and good shock absorption.

5. Weight

Lightweight boots can improve speed and agility. However, they should not compromise durability. Balance is key; read reviews from www.sportsgearlab.com to find the right options.

FAQ

What are turf soccer boots?
Turf soccer boots are specially designed footwear for playing soccer on artificial turf surfaces. They feature unique stud patterns that provide optimal grip and traction.

Why can’t I use regular soccer cleats on turf?
Regular soccer cleats designed for grass may have longer studs that can grip too hard on turf, leading to injuries like ankle twists or knee strains.

How do I know my size in turf soccer boots?
It’s essential to try on different brands, as sizes can vary. A snug fit without being too tight is ideal.

Can I use turf soccer boots on grass?
While turf boots can be used on grass, they are not optimal for soft ground or muddy conditions. It’s best to use firm ground boots for natural grass.

What materials are best for turf soccer boots?
Both synthetic materials and leather are great options. Synthetic boots are lighter and more breathable, while leather offers durability and comfort.

How often should I replace my turf soccer boots?
It depends on frequency of use, but generally, every 6-12 months is a good rule of thumb, especially if you notice significant wear.

Do turf soccer boots provide good ankle support?
Most turf boots are low-cut, focusing on agility. If you need more ankle support, consider wearing high-top models or using ankle braces.
